Senior Manager, Technology Change Risk Oversight

Capital One is one of the fastest growing organizations in the world today, powered by our passion for our customers. We are serious about technology, we dream big, and we execute:
Capital One moved our entire enterprise to the public cloud over the course of five years. Just as we prioritize driving innovation through technology, we equally prioritize cybersecurity, reliability, and managing technology risk.

Technology Risk Management (TRM) is a small organization that packs a big punch. The ~100 professionals in TRM are trusted experts who oversee ~14,000 developers at Capital One. We raise the bar for excellence in cybersecurity, reliability, and tech risk. We shape strategy and decisions, challenge activities to ensure they meet our standards, and perform independent tests of our security and technology risk.

Our business leaders must make technology decisions constantly. TRM makes sure they have the tech risk information they need to make good decisions. Associates within TRM are highly-skilled information security, cybersecurity, site reliability engineering, technology, and risk management professionals. They have a wealth of experience and a demonstrated ability to add value with their advice and to deliver high-impact results.

Essential Functions (Responsibilities)
  • Provide technical leadership in assessing the practices of designing, developing, testing and implementing cloud native solutions to crucial business problems through thoughtful use of industry best practices and Capital One policy.
  • Evaluate proposed and approved cloud technical solutions for automation, resiliency, performance, scalability, and security including appropriate tradeoffs, risks and opportunities.
  • Evaluate/assess complex technological and business environment migrations to the cloud and integrated end-to-end solution options.
  • Build and maintain relationships with technical leaders, business owners, engineers, and other stakeholders to understand and evaluate implementation plans, business priorities and technical solutions to ensure risks are well communicated and understood by the key stakeholders.
  • Keep up-to-date on cutting edge technology, standards, protocols and tools in areas relevant to the rapidly changing environment at Capital One, specifically cloud native architecture, serverless, and emerging AWS services.
  • Demonstrate strong analytical, problem-solving, and decision-making skills.
  • Communicate and drive highly complex technology solutions to broad audiences including executives, business leaders, product managers, legal experts, security specialists, and software engineers.
  • Define, structure and plan work independently.
  • Perform independent risk assessment of our cloud environment focusing on architecture, engineering, networking, governance.
  • Provide expertise and advice regarding the effectiveness of device configurations, IT architecture, or IT engineering solutions.
  • Consult with risk owners on the design and implementation or adjustment of mitigating controls associated with emerging technologies.
  • Draft and publish independent reports for risk owners, senior management, and other stakeholders regarding risks associated with new or emerging technologies.

Finally, as a member of a growing organization, you will have the opportunity to shape and further refine your portfolio commensurate with the priorities of the organization and the company. The demands and high‑visibility nature of this position requires an expert with a proven ability to work independently in a fast‑paced environment and who can begin contributing immediately.

Basic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s Degree or military experience
  • At least 6 years of experience managing, consulting, auditing, or working in the fields of information security or information technology
  • At least 3 years experience with Public Cloud implementations
Preferred Qualifications
  • Master’s Degree in Computer Science or in an Engineering discipline
  • Professional certification (AWS Certified Solutions Architect, AWS Certified Security Specialty, AWS Sys Ops Administrator, or Certified Information Systems Security Professional (CISSP))
